‘Nothing humanitarian or humane’ about Israel’s humanitarian city plan: UNRWA

UNRWA director of external relations and communications Tamara Alrifai has told Al Jazeera that “there is nothing humanitarian or humane about the so-called humanitarian city” that Israel is talking about setting up, according to a post by the UN agency on X.

“Calling it [a] humanitarian city (…) is an insult to the humanitarian principles,” said Alrifai, adding that the act of seeking to confine the Gaza population to a space highly vetted by Israeli forces would turn Gaza from the largest to “the most confined and overpopulated open-air prison in the world”.

She that the plan would create “massive concentration camps” for Palestinians at the border with Egypt.
